Как проверить лог компилятора в sql developer? - PullRequest
38 голосов
/ 28 сентября 2010

Я получаю эту ошибку:

Ошибки: проверьте журнал компилятора

Как просмотреть журнал компилятора в Oracle SQL Developer?

Ответы [ 3 ]

39 голосов
/ 28 сентября 2010

control-shift-L должен открыть журнал (ы) для вас.по умолчанию это будет журнал сообщений, но если вы создадите элемент, создающий ошибку, появится журнал компилятора (для меня поле отображается внизу в середине слева).

, если журнал сообщенийэто единственный журнал, который появляется, просто повторно запустите элемент, который вызвал сбой, и журнал компилятора покажет

, например, нажмите Control-shift-L и выполните это

CREATE OR REPLACE FUNCTION TEST123() IS
BEGIN
VAR := 2;
end TEST123;

и вы увидите сообщение «Ошибка (1,18): PLS-00103: обнаружен символ«) »при ожидании одного из следующих действий: текущее удаление существует раньше«

(вы также можете увидетьэто в «View - Log»)

Еще одна вещь, если у вас возникла проблема с (функция || package || процедура), если вы выполняете кодирование через интерфейс SQL Developer (путем поискарассматриваемый объект на вкладке соединений и его редактирование, ошибка будет немедленно отображена (и даже подчеркнута время от времени)

12 голосов
/ 08 октября 2010

Я также могу использовать

показать ошибки;

В листе sql.

6 голосов
/ 25 сентября 2015

Чтобы увидеть ваш логин SQL Developer, нажмите:

CTRL + SHIFT + L (или CTRL + CMD + L в macOS)

или

Просмотр -> Журнал

или используя запрос mysql

показать ошибки;

...